Step 1: Inspection and Assessment
Our technicians will conduct a thorough inspection of your home’s foundation to identify the source of the water damage. We’ll use specialized equipment to detect any hidden moisture and assess the extent of the damage. This is a crucial step in preventing further damage and ensuring that our restoration efforts are effective.
Step 2: Water Removal
Once we’ve identified the source of the water damage, our technicians will use specialized equipment to remove standing water from your property. We’ll use powerful pumps and vacuums to extract water from your basement, crawlspace, or other affected areas. This is a critical step in preventing further damage and reducing the risk of mold and mildew growth.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
After removing standing water, our technicians will use specialized equipment to dry out the affected area. We’ll use high-velocity fans and dehumidifiers to remove excess moisture and prevent mold and mildew growth. This is an essential step in preventing further damage and ensuring that your property is safe and healthy.
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ing
Once the affected area is dry, our technicians will clean and sanitize the space to remove any remaining moisture and prevent mold and mildew growth. We’ll use specialized cleaning solutions and equipment to ensure that your property is safe and healthy. This is a critical step in preventing further damage and ensuring that your property is restored to its original condition.
Step 5: Restoration and Repair
Finally, our technicians will work with you to restore your property to its original condition. We’ll repair any damaged walls, floors, or ceilings, and ensure that your property is safe and healthy. Concrete Water Damage Restoration Cost in Ankeny, IA
The cost of Concrete Water Damage Restoration in Ankeny, IA will v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will provide you with a detailed estimate of the costs involved, including any necessary repairs or replacements. We’ll work closely with you to ensure that you’re satisfied with the results and that your property is restored to its original condition.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Inspection and Assessment | $100 – $500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, and local conditions |
| Water Removal | $500 – $2,500 | Amount of water, size of affected area, and equipment needed |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, equipment needed, and duration of drying process |
| Cleaning and Sanitizing |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, type of cleaning solutions needed, and duration of cleaning process |
| Restoration and Repair | $1,000 – $5,000 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, and materials needed for repairs |
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ment of your property and the extent of the damage. We offer free estimates and will work closely with you to ensure that you’re satisfied with the results.
